Just my two cents here but there is not much for night life in Vale, so why would anyone be concerned about going to the bar in Vale. The Moose is ok to have dinner then watch the game but vale is no revy...

I like the cougar because it is neat, clean, tidy and well taken care of. We use to stay at the Summitt river lodge but could not get dates to work out with Connie.

If you are looking to pay one price and eat, sleep, sled then Summitt or Cougar are the places to stay - Just my 2 cents-. I am not knocking the Canoe, but there rooms are small and they do not have any real drying facillities at the hotel. It is however a nice place to stay.
